- The distance between Gourdon, France and Ilorin, Nigeria is approximately 4,045 km or 2,513 mi.
- To reach Gourdon in this distance one would set out from Ilorin bearing 356.2°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Gourdon bearing 354.7° or N .
- Gourdon has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Ilorin has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Gourdon is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Ilorin is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 13.9 °C (25.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.7 °C (21.1°F) more in Gourdon.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 384 mm (15.1 in) less which is equivalent to 384 l/m² (9.42 US gal/ft²) or 3,840,000 l/ha (410,521 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 28.6° lower in Gourdon than in Ilorin.
